5, Curzon Road, Liverpool is recorded publicly as a period freehold house across 1,140 ft2 of internal area, sitting on a 102 m2 plot.
Locally, houses of this size normally have 4 bedrooms with a garden.
Our estimate of the sale value of 5, Curzon Road, Liverpool is £221,697 and its rental estimate is £1,155 per month, given the available information and assuming reasonable condition.
Curzon Road, Liverpool, L22 falls within the L22 postal district, in the borough of Sefton.
5, Curzon Road, Liverpool has a single entry in the Land Registry from October 2014 and a single entry in the EPC database dated December 2014.

For 5, Curzon Road, Liverpool, we estimate a market value of £232,782 and a rental value of £1,213 per month when presented in very good decorative order. Should the property require extensive cosmetic improvement, those figures would reduce to £206,178 and £1,075 per month respectively.
Over the last year, 5, Curzon Road, Liverpool has seen its estimated sale value increase by £4,681 (2.1%) and its estimated rental value grow by £36 per month (3.1%). This results in an estimated gross rental yield of 6.3%.
HM Land Registry records the plot of land for 5, Curzon Road, Liverpool as measuring 102 m2.
That makes it the 11th largest plot in the postcode, where all 33 other houses have recorded plot data.
5, Curzon Road, Liverpool has an Energy Performance Rating (EPC) of G. This is based on the most recent assessment, dated 05 Dec 2014.
The property is not connected to mains gas and has fully double glazed windows. It is heated using No system present: electric heaters assumed.
The most recent sale of 5, Curzon Road, Liverpool completed on 23rd October 2014 at £90,000 and was recorded by HM Land Registry as a freehold house.
Since 1995 this is the property's only sale.
Values of comparable properties have risen by 97.1% over the period since October 2014.
